Analysis

In 2025, population ages 65 and above, male in Cape Verde stood at 15,008. That is the highest value across all 66 years on record.

The figure is up 6.2% on the previous year and up 52.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population ages 65 and above, male in Cape Verde peaked at 15,008 in 2025 and was at its lowest, 2,684, in 1960.

Cape Verde ranks 176th of 215 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 66 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 4,282 2,684 6,625 10
1970s 7,914 7,135 8,268 10
1980s 7,510 7,340 7,759 10
1990s 7,966 7,378 8,604 10
2000s 9,315 8,738 9,620 10
2010s 9,979 9,367 11,280 10
2020s 13,141 11,676 15,008 6
